Question 966410: In ΔABC, if m ∠A = m∠C, m∠B = ß (where ß is an acute angle), and BC = x, which expression gives the length of b, the side opposite ∠B ?

By the law of sines,
a%2Fsin%28A%29=b%2Fsin%28B%29=c%2Fsin%28C%29
A=C
.
B=beta
.
a=x
.
A%2BB%2BC=180%7D%7D%0D%0A%7B%7B%7B2A=180-beta
A=90-beta%2F2
So then,
x%2Fsin%2890-beta%2F2%29=b%2Fsin%28beta%29
b=x%2A%28sin%28beta%29%2Fsin%2890-beta%2F2%29%29
highlight%28b=x%2A%28sin%28beta%29%2Fcos%28beta%2F2%29%29%29
